West Ham United reportedly fear that Manchester United could block their efforts to sign Jesse Lingard this summer.

West Ham United are reportedly fearful that Manchester United could end up blocking a move for Jesse Lingard.

The England international enjoyed a stellar six months on loan at the London Stadium, chipping in with nine goals and five assists as West Ham sealed Europa League qualification.

Lingard's long-term future remains unclear, although David Moyes has expressed his desire to keep him on the books as the Hammers prepare for continental competition.

However, The Sun reports that Ole Gunnar Solskjaer is determined to keep hold of the attacker, and Man United will attempt to stop any efforts to prise him away this summer.

Lingard himself has spoken out about how he will "take away" the memories from his time at West Ham, seemingly hinting that he will not be linking up with Moyes's side again.

The 28-year-old's Red Devils deal expires at the end of next season, and he failed to make a single Premier League appearance for the club during the first half of the 2020-21 season.
